Pathway Massage: Unlocking the Power of Bodywork

For centuries, humans have sought ways to heal and balance their bodies, minds, and spirits. One ancient practice that has gained popularity in recent years is pathway massage, also known as “pathways” or “mechanical pathways.” This holistic approach combines traditional bodywork techniques with modern understanding of human anatomy and physiology to promote deep relaxation, pain relief, and overall well-being. In this article, we will delve into the world of pathway massage, exploring its history, key benefits, and how it can be incorporated into your self-care routine.

Key Points:

1. What is Pathway Massage?
Pathway massage is a form of bodywork that involves applying pressure to specific points on the body, known as “pathways,” to stimulate healing and relaxation. This technique is based on the idea that the human body has a network of pathways or channels that can be manipulated to promote balance and harmony. 2. History of Pathway Massage
The concept of pathway massage has its roots in ancient Eastern cultures, where it was used to treat various ailments and conditions. In the Western world, this practice gained popularity in the early 20th century, particularly among osteopaths and chiropractors who incorporated similar techniques into their practices. 3. How Does Pathway Massage Work?
Pathway massage works by applying pressure to specific points on the body, which stimulates the release of tension and stress. This can be achieved through various techniques, including manual manipulation, deep tissue massage, or even energetic pathways like acupuncture. The goal is to restore balance to the body’s energy system, promoting relaxation, pain relief, and overall well-being. 4. Benefits of Pathway Massage
The benefits of pathway massage are numerous and diverse. Some of the most common benefits include: * Reduced stress and anxiety * Improved sleep quality * Enhanced pain management * Increased flexibility and range of motion * Improved circulation and lymphatic function 5. Precautions and Contraindications
While pathway massage is generally considered safe, there are certain precautions and contraindications to be aware of: * Pregnancy: avoid applying pressure to the lower back or abdomen during pregnancy. * Acute injury: do not receive pathway massage if you have an acute injury, such as a recent sprain or strain. * Neurological conditions: consult with a healthcare professional before receiving pathway massage if you have a neurological condition, such as multiple sclerosis.
